Techniques for Pressure Washing
When it comes to pressure washing, understanding the right methods is crucial for securing the best outcomes while protecting your home’s exterior. A significant method is the straight spray technique, in which the nozzle is directed directly at the area being cleaned. This works well for hardy materials such as concrete and brick though can be too aggressive for more delicate surfaces like wood and vinyl siding. Adjusting the proximity of the spray from the area can assist regulate the intensity and minimize any risk of damage.
An additional effective technique is the use of a fan spray pattern. This wider spray disperses the water over a greater area, making it ideal for cleaning sensitive surfaces. As Pressure Washing Company wash your home’s outside, including windows and more fragile sidings, this technique allows for increased even coverage without the danger of erosion. It is crucial to use the right nozzle size and spray angle to ensure thorough cleaning and maintaining the condition of the materials.
Lastly, incorporating a two-step cleaning process can improve results. Start with a pre-treatment using a biodegradable cleaning solution, which allows for the breakdown of grime and mildew. After applying the cleaner and allowing it sit for a few minutes, proceed with pressure washing to effectively remove the remaining dirt. This method not only ensure a cleaner surface and also reduces the need for high pressure, extending the life of your home’s surfaces.
